Ads
Henwood
- Phone:
- 02392 466681 (+44-02392 466681)
- City/Area:
- Hampshire
- Country:
- United Kingdom
Company Profile
Henwood is a company at United Kingdom,Address is 35 Sinah La; Hayling Island; Hampshire; PO11 0HH
- Address: 35 Sinah La; Hayling Island; Hampshire; PO11 0HH
- City/Area: Hampshire
- Country: United Kingdom
- Category: Unclassifiable Establishments
Map
This is Google map of Henwood address:35 Sinah La; Hayling Island; Hampshire; PO11 0HH,Hampshire,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.